Polish Film Chronicle 63/03A

Nikita Khrushchev, the secretary general of the CPSU is on his way to Berlin for a rally of the Socialist Unity Party of Germany. He stopped in Warsaw. He was welcomed by Wladyslaw Gomulka and Prime Minister Jozef Cyrankiewicz. A severe winter is troublesome but open-pit mines work – they heat up frozen excavators… Meanwhile, in the mountains in the province of Alberta in Canada, helicopters help to build electric traction. A new furniture shop called ‘Emilia’ waits for its customers in Warsaw. Viewers are encouraged to see the ‘Teatr Osobny’ by Miron Bialoszewski. People dance the twist in the Palace of Youth in Katowice and in entire Europe. Brigitte Bardot and Charles Aznavour admire the show of a Belgian circus. Sports: ‘Wisla Cracow’ basketball players promoted to the next stage of the European Cup. Eva and Pavel Romanovie dance on ice.
